Transaction 32ec56877b8b3666d7b16733b01727dda9f802c7bef3b4d27f2b8d7fd13a1849
1 Input
2 Outputs
- 32ec56877b8b3666d7b16733b01727dda9f802c7bef3b4d27f2b8d7fd13a1849:0
- 32ec56877b8b3666d7b16733b01727dda9f802c7bef3b4d27f2b8d7fd13a1849:1
value 17997517
address 1KU6Q6Xp5K81Le7BeUmJkbshFtFi2mXJT6
value 20000000
address 3BTADjuGd6DzmAdoqQc2V6eP5x9gz4YWAg